Output 1abd85fb1c03d1deebe3c828fecca5a30476f8fe6042fb999fd0c071c829b55a:73

value
504185
script pubkey
OP_0 OP_PUSHBYTES_20 28f65b5dbca8c52e392eca0cd59edb1d4a6310d5
address
bc1q9rm9khdu4rzjuwfwegxdt8kmr49xxyx4wgtpv6
transaction
1abd85fb1c03d1deebe3c828fecca5a30476f8fe6042fb999fd0c071c829b55a
confirmations
122005
spent
true